Sales brisk at Plaza townhouses
Twenty percent of the Plaza on New York condominiums sold out in two days at the recent grand opening. The event built on the success of the Plaza townhouses, one of the fastest selling communities in the Chicago area.
Versatile floor plans drew the attention of young professionals sharing space, penthouses caught the attention of empty nesters looking to simplify without compromise, and everyone liked the maintenance-free convenience.
Another reason this community is selling so quickly is the prime location -- near the northwest corner of Aurora's New York Street and Route 59, across from the Westfield Fox Valley shopping mall and next to the Route 59 Metra station.
A full-size building model, as well as a fully furnished model, are available for viewing.
Monthly assessments cover heat, water, sewer, garbage pickup, common area assessments, insurance, and use of all common areas -- including a fitness room, which includes treadmills, elliptical trainers and weight machines.
The Plaza condos have many on-site amenities, and flexible floor plans with options such as dual master suites and dens.
For example, penthouses come with 10-foot ceilings, custom windows, and can be individualized with a number of custom options.
Building amenities include:
• A Wall Street Center fully equipped with conference room amenities.
• The Manhattan Room, great for parties, special events or an informal gathering. This room includes a kitchen and bar for catering or serving, a fireplace, living room seating and a large-screen TV.
• A movie room with theater-style seating, a theater-quality sound system, and a projection TV.
• The Plaza Terrace, the perfect spot for indoor and outdoor dining or just relaxing with friends and family.
The Plaza condos, priced from the $190,000s, feature a square footage range of 1,017 to 1,630, and floor plans that range from one bedroom and one bath; to two bedrooms, a bonus den and two baths.
Kitchens amenities include 42-inch maple cabinets, granite countertops, pantries, and either a breakfast bar or an island.
Each condo comes with one storage space, which is conveniently located on the same floor as the residence. Additional storage spaces are available.
Eventually the first floor corners of these five-story buildings will include retail shops.
The Plaza is part of the Station Boulevard venture located between the Westfield Fox Valley Mall and the Route 59 Metra station. Adding to the convenience is a trolley system that will take residents to local venues. The project is an eight-minute or less drive from schools, grocery stores, a new Rush/Copley Medical Center, a movie theater and a number of restaurants.
